CARMEL — Ken Wendeln is fed up with scammers calling his cell phone.
“I’m sick and tired of people taking up my time on things that are not real,” said Wendeln. The Carmel man received a phone call from a collection agent about an outstanding bill for blood work.
But this didn’t sound like a scam. It sounded legitimate. “I knew that I am getting blood tests,” said Wendeln. “I knew that was real. They said I owed $594 from a company called US Diagnostics.”
When he pressed for details, like which doctor or the date of the visit, the agent wouldn’t give him more information. “She was very harsh about saying no, that’s all I’ve got,” said Wendeln. “She said it’s overdue and you need to pay it.”…
